Output 3ab1eed7be8260a0c0b9d073eaa97d1694f990088a5d7944200f4637b18bb265:83

value
22455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8233a329261eb2374494f3bbe4665802ff601b OP_EQUAL
address
3EmpXYnR2ZCromyAs63BhghukMG45BxfuH
transaction
3ab1eed7be8260a0c0b9d073eaa97d1694f990088a5d7944200f4637b18bb265
spent
true